DESCRIPTION

WARNINGTo avoid injury from accidental air bag deployment, read and carefully follow all SERVICE PRECAUTIONS and DISABLING & ACTIVATING AIR BAG SYSTEM procedures in AIR BAG SYSTEM SAFETY article in GENERAL SERVICING.
CAUTIONWhen battery is disconnected, radio will go into anti-theft protection mode. Obtain radio anti-theft protection code from owner prior to servicing vehicle.

The air conditioning system is a cycling clutch type. System components include front evaporator, compressor, A/C pressure switch, expansion valve, receiver-drier, control panel and condenser. If vehicle is equipped with auxiliary (rear) heating and A/C, additional components include auxiliary evaporator and expansion valve. Control panel has 14 push buttons and a display window. Automatic settings remain in memory after ignition is turned off and resume next time ignition is turned on. Manually selected settings such as fan speed and air distribution remain stored in memory for one hour after turning ignition off. After an hour or more, system will restart in automatic mode with previous automatic settings.
